Ripple is one of the oldest names in crypto World. Founded in 2012, Ripple is changing the way international money transfers are being made. Its platform allows faster money transfers with lower costs. Banks and payment providers seem to like this idea. Hundreds of banks and payment providers are on board with Ripple, and the number keeps on increasing. Ripple token (XRP) was one of the stars of last year.
Starting from $0.006 at the beginning of 2017, the price got close to $4 at some point. Securing its spot on the top of the lists, Ripple can be found on a lot of exchanges, which is one of the main ways to sell your Ripple. You can open an account on a trusted exchange and transfer your Ripple to your wallet. Some exchanges support XRP-USD pair so you can sell your Ripple for fiat.
In most of the other exchanges, you need to trade your Ripple for Bitcoin. Make sure to read about the Know-Your-Customer (KYC) policy before you transfer your Ripple. Most exchanges require a proof of identity before allowing withdrawals. Another way to sell your Ripple is through the peer to peer marketplace. You want to sell your Ripple and somebody wants to buy it? As simple as that, the marketplace connects buyers and sellers.
